  • Question: How do I install the Aquila AQ-86 concert ukulele strings?

    Answer: Installing the Aquila AQ-86 concert ukulele strings involves a straightforward process. Start by removing the old strings and cleaning the fretboard. Feed one end of the new string through the corresponding bridge hole, then tie a secure knot. Next, bring the other end up to the tuning post, feeding it through and pulling taut. Wind the string around the post and tune to pitch. This method ensures the strings stay in place and can help prevent slippage during play, enhancing your overall playing experience.
  • Question: What are the benefits of a low G tuning with these strings?

    Answer: Using Low G tuning with the Aquila AQ-86 strings allows for a broader tonal range and greater musical versatility. This tuning enhances bass notes and adds depth to chords, which makes it a favorite among composers and performers. The low G string can provide a fuller sound and allow for more complex fingerpicking and strumming patterns, making pieces with varied rhythm and basslines come to life. Players looking to expand their musical repertoire will appreciate how this tuning enables them to explore diverse genres, from folk to jazz.

Aquila Ukulele Accessories Editorial Review

The Aquila Red Series AQ-86 Concert Ukulele Strings in Low G come with a white G string, green C string, blue E string, and a red A string. The low G string is wound, but the feel is not as rough as other wound strings, and overall the strings are comfortable to play. The strings make a significant difference in sound quality, making an inexpensive concert ukulele sound $50.00 more expensive. However, some users have experienced issues with buzzing against the frets when strummed, especially with the C string. Some also report issues with breakage.
